But first, this will be the third cabinet member to leave the administration,
the Labor Secretary, Lori Chavez,
DeRemer. She was a bit of a controversial pick for this position. The White House said,
Labor Secretary, Doreemer, will be leaving the administration to take a position in the private
sector. She has done a phenomenal job in her role of protecting American workers, enacting fair
labor practices, and helping Americans gain additional skills to improve their lives. There have
been accusations of personal travel on taxpayer-funded trips, and her husband was accused by two women
of touching them inappropriately. One was a, quote, extended embrace. He was banned from going on
labor department premises.

The United States Citizenship and Immigration Services is revetting migrants who were awarded green cards, asylum, and other benefits under President Joe Biden.
This is from the agency director.
In terms of the people that are perpetrating fraud, stop.
we are going to find you.
And if you've already committed fraud
and you think you've got away with it,
we're going back.
He said we are now going to look at old cases.
We're going back and revetting cases
for people who were granted green cards
and granted other benefits when there was no vetting,
but there's vetting now.
And we're looking at these old cases,
so be prepared to face the consequences.
Our fraud detection and national security team
completed investigations into more than 21,000 cases,
identifying fraud in 65% of them.
New food standards.
rules went into effect in Florida yesterday.
So no longer can you use
food stamps to buy soda, energy drinks
and candy. And also
Twinkies, Ho-Ho's, Swiss rolls,
Baker's Treat Cupcakes,
Chips Ahoey, Keebler, Chips Deluxe,
famous Amos chocolate chip cookies,
Market Pantry Chocolate Chip cookies,
Oreos, Ben's original chocolate chip cookie
sandwiches and great value, twist and shout
cookies to be specific.
This is a two-year program.
Officials will track the results.

Now the O'Reilly Update brings you something you might not know.
190 years ago today, an 18-minute battle forever changed the course of North American history.
The skirmish led directly to the liberation of Texas from Mexico.
Here's the story behind the Battle of San Jacie.
In the early 19th century, thousands of American settlers sought land and opportunity in the vast Texas territory.
By 1835, both white and Hispanics sought freedom from their rulers in Mexico City, which
controlled the land.
The revolution began with the battle on Gonzales.
a series of catastrophic defeats, the Texians sought safety in an old Spanish fort in
San Antonio called the Alamo.
There too, the Mexican army was victorious and slaughtered the defenders of the Alamo.
The Texian soldiers, and you notice I am saying Texian, that was the original pronunciation,
were led by Samuel Houston.
They retreated east toward the San Jacinto River.
The Mexicans, under the leadership of General Santa Ana, followed.
On April 21st, 1836, Houston launched a surprise counter-attack.
His army of just 900, quickly defeated Santa Ana and his men.
Their battle cry, remember the Alamo.
In less than 20 minutes, nearly 700 Mexicans were killed.
Less than 10 Texans die.
died. General Santa Ana was captured the next day. To secure his own release, Santa Ana signed a peace
treaty with the revolutionaries. Texas was free, Sam Houston, the president. But the new
republic did not last long. The nation was annexed into the USA as a 28th seed in 1845,
and here's something else you might not know. The territory of the United States. The territory
of Texas is one of the few places in America to be controlled by six different countries.
The flags of Spain, France, Mexico, the Republic of Texas, the Confederate states of America,
and the good all USA have all flown over the Lone Star State.
